In 2024, RBDIS achieves revenue of 733 k€. Revenue is declining over the period 2020-2024 (CAGR: -68.6%). Vs 2023, growth of +10% (665 k€ -> 733 k€). After deducting consumption (0 €), gross margin stands at 733 k€, i.e. a rate of 100%. This ratio measures the ability to generate value from commercial activity. EBITDA (= Gross margin - Personnel expenses - Taxes) reaches -4 k€, representing -0.5% of revenue. Positive scissor effect: EBITDA margin improves by +5.0 pts, sign of improved operational efficiency. Negative EBITDA means operations do not cover current expenses: concerning situation. Ultimately, net income (= EBIT +/- financial result +/- exceptional - corporate tax) amounts to 1.4 M€, i.e. 191.7% of revenue. This profit can be retained or distributed to shareholders.

Solvency and debt ratios
The debt ratio (= Financial debt / Equity x 100) stands at 201%. Critical situation: debt significantly exceeds equity, severely limiting borrowing capacity and exposing the company to default risk. Financial autonomy (= Equity / Total assets x 100) reaches 33%. The balance between equity and debt is satisfactory. Debt repayment capacity (= Financial debt / Cash flow) indicates it would take 8.3 years of cash flow to repay all financial debt. Beyond 7 years, banks generally consider credit risk as high. Cash flow represents 191.1% of revenue. Cash flow measures resources generated by operations, available for investment and debt repayment. This high level provides strong self-financing capacity.

Working capital requirement (WCR) and payment terms
Working capital requirement (WCR) measures the cash timing gap between customer collections and supplier/inventory payments. Average customer payment term: 69 days (formula: Customer receivables / Revenue incl. VAT x 360). Supplier term: 110 days. Excellent situation: suppliers finance 41 days of the operating cycle (retail model). Overall, WCR represents 152 days of revenue, i.e. 310 k€ to permanently finance.
